(Suggest an Edit or Addition)According to Wikipedia, Arthur DeWitt Ripley was an American film screenwriter, editor, producer, and director. Biography In 1923, he joined the Mack Sennett studio as a comedy writer. In the 1920s, he worked closely with Frank Capra churning out screenplays for many movies. After breaking with Capra and the Sennett studio, Ripley again returned to being a gag-writer, screenwriter, and occasional director, making short films with such comedians as W. C. Fields and Edgar Kennedy. His directorial work in the 1940s, Voice in the Wind and The Chase , were both critical successes, but neither film was a box office hit.
